全パッケージ クラス階層 このパッケージ 前項目 次項目 インデックス
クラス java.sql.Time
java.lang.Object
|
+----java.util.Date
|
+----java.sql.Time
- public class Time
- extends Date
このクラスは、java.util.Date のラッパーです。このラッパーによって JDBC はこれを SQL TIME 値として識別できます。time 値の JDBC エスケープ構文をサポートするためのフォーマットと構文解析を提供します。
-
Time(int, int, int)
- Time オブジェクトを作成する。
-
Time(long)
- ミリ秒の値を使用して、Time オブジェクトを作成する。
-
getDate()
- この date によって表現される月内の日付を返す。
-
getDay()
- この date によって表現される週内の日付を返す。
-
getMonth()
- この date によって表現される月を返す。
-
getYear()
- この date によって表現される年数から 1900 を引いた値を返す。
-
setDate(int)
- この date の月内の日付を指定された値に設定する。
-
setMonth(int)
- この date の月を指定された値に設定する。
-
setTime(long)
- ミリ秒の値を使用して、Time を設定する。
-
setYear(int)
- この date の年数を指定された値に 1900 を加えた値に設定する。
-
toString()
- 時間を JDBC date エスケープ形式にフォーマットする。
-
valueOf(String)
- JDBC time エスケープ形式中の文字列を Time 値に変換する。
Time
public Time(int hour,
int minute,
int second)
- Time オブジェクトを作成します。
- パラメータ:
- hour - 0 から 23 まで。
- minute - 0 から 59 まで。
- second - 0 から 59 まで。
Time
public Time(long time)
- ミリ秒の値を使用して、Time オブジェクトを作成します。
- パラメータ:
- time - 1970年1月1日、00時:00分:00秒 GMT(グリニッジ標準時) を起点とした時間をミリ秒で表した値。
setTime
public void setTime(long time)
- ミリ秒の値を使用して、Time を設定します。
- パラメータ:
- time - 1970年1月1日、00時:00分:00秒 GMT(グリニッジ標準時) を起点とした時間をミリ秒で表した値。
- オーバーライド:
- クラス Date の setTime
valueOf
public static Time valueOf(String s)
- JDBC time エスケープ形式中の文字列を Time 値に変換します。
- パラメータ:
- s - "hh:mm:ss" 形式の時間。
- 返り値:
- 対応する時間。
toString
public String toString()
- 時間を JDBC date エスケープ形式にフォーマットする。
- 返り値:
- hh:mm:ss 形式の文字列。
- オーバーライド:
- クラス Date の toString
getYear
public int getYear()
- この date によって表現される年数から 1900 を引いた値を返します。
- オーバーライド:
- クラス Date の getYear
getMonth
public int getMonth()
- この date によって表現される月を返します。
- オーバーライド:
- クラス Date の getMonth
getDay
public int getDay()
- この date によって表現される週内の日付を返します。
- オーバーライド:
- クラス Date の getDay
getDate
public int getDate()
- この date によって表現される月内の日付を返します。
- オーバーライド:
- クラス Date の getDate
setYear
public void setYear(int i)
- この date の年数を指定された値に 1900 を加えた値に設定します。
- オーバーライド:
- クラス Date の setYear
setMonth
public void setMonth(int i)
- この date の月を指定された値に設定します。
- オーバーライド:
- クラス Date の setMonth
setDate
public void setDate(int i)
- この date の月内の日付を指定された値に設定します。
- オーバーライド:
- クラス DatesetDate
全パッケージ クラス階層 このパッケージ 前項目 次項目 インデックス